Trading Pokémon on DS Emulators

To trade Pokémon on DS emulators, players can use the in-game trade feature, which allows them to exchange Pokémon between two emulator instances. This method requires both emulator instances to be running the same Pokémon game and to have the Pokémon they want to trade in their respective party or boxes.

3. How Do You Trade Pokémon on Emulator Melon DS?

To trade Pokémon on melonDS, you need to turn off the frame rate limit, save both emulator instances in a Poké Center, and then restart both instances and enter the Union Room at the same time.

4. Can I Trade Pokémon with Melonds?

Yes, you can trade Pokémon using melonDS, as it supports local multiplayer connections, allowing you to trade Pokémon between two emulator instances.

5. Can Melonds Trade with a Real DS?

No, melonDS cannot trade Pokémon with a Nintendo DS console, as it does not support wireless communication with DS consoles.
